Problem 382

For the following exercises, use the Remainder Theorem to find the remainder. $$ \left(x^{4}+5 x^{3}-4 x-17\right) \div(x+1) $$

Problem 383

For the following exercises, use the Remainder Theorem to find the remainder. $$ \left(-3 x^{2}+6 x+24\right) \div(x-4) $$

Problem 384

For the following exercises, use the Remainder Theorem to find the remainder. $$ \left(5 x^{5}-4 x^{4}+3 x^{3}-2 x^{2}+x-1\right) \div(x+6) $$

Problem 385

For the following exercises, use the Remainder Theorem to find the remainder. $$ \left(x^{4}-1\right) \div(x-4) $$

Problem 386

For the following exercises, use the Remainder Theorem to find the remainder. $$ \left(3 x^{3}+4 x^{2}-8 x+2\right) \div(x-3) $$

Problem 387

For the following exercises, use the Remainder Theorem to find the remainder. $$ \left(4 x^{3}+5 x^{2}-2 x+7\right) \div(x+2) $$

Problem 388

For the following exercises, use the Factor Theorem to find all real zeros for the given polynomial function and one factor. $$ f(x)=2 x^{3}-9 x^{2}+13 x-6 ; x-1 $$

Problem 389

For the following exercises, use the Factor Theorem to find all real zeros for the given polynomial function and one factor. $$ f(x)=2 x^{3}+x^{2}-5 x+2 ; x+2 $$

Problem 390

For the following exercises, use the Factor Theorem to find all real zeros for the given polynomial function and one factor. $$ f(x)=3 x^{3}+x^{2}-20 x+12 ; x+3 $$

Problem 391

For the following exercises, use the Factor Theorem to find all real zeros for the given polynomial function and one factor. $$ f(x)=2 x^{3}+3 x^{2}+x+6 ; \quad x+2 $$
